Part 3: Password Recovery Guide (Reset Without Losing Configuration)

Forgot your password? Don’t panic. The 3650 supports a service password recovery mechanism enabled by default. This allows you to reset the password without wiping configuration files, unlike typical consumer routers.

Step-by-Step Recovery via Console Port

Step Action Description
1 Connect Attach a PC with terminal software to the switch console using a null-modem serial cable.
2 Set Baud Rate Configure terminal software to 9600 baud.
3 Power Cycle Turn off the switch.
4 Enter Boot Menu Reconnect power and press the Mode button within 15 seconds while the System LED flashes green.
5 Release Mode Continue pressing until the LED briefly turns amber and then solid green, then release.
6 Perform Recovery Use the boot menu/ROMmon to reset the password without losing configuration.


Part 4: Security Best Practices for Catalyst 3650

1. Enforce Strong Passwords

  • Avoid common words like cisco or admin.
  • Mix lowercase, uppercase, digits, and special characters.
  • Avoid repeating characters more than three times consecutively.
  • Recommended minimum length: 8 characters (max 32 by default).

2. Configure AAA Authentication (Local Database)

Enable AAA to secure logins and privilege access:

Switch# configure terminal
Switch(config)# aaa new-model
Switch(config)# aaa authentication login default local
Switch(config)# aaa authorization exec local
Switch(config)# username [name] privilege 15 password 0 [password]

3. Save Configuration

Switch# copy running-config startup-config
